Belleair Beach, FL, embodies a serene coastal lifestyle, where stunning views and a welcoming community atmosphere create an idyllic retreat. The area boasts easy access to beautiful sandy shores, perfect for sunbathing, swimming, and beachcombing. A range of rental options, from cozy beachfront condos to charming single-family homes, cater to diverse preferences and budgets, ensuring everyone can find their perfect spot by the sea.
Local parks, including the picturesque Walsingham Park and the vibrant Pier 60 Park, offer picnic areas and scenic walking paths, inviting residents to embrace the outdoors. Cultural experiences flourish in the area, with events similar to the annual Belleair Beach Community Festival celebrating local art, music, and food. Nearby, the Clearwater Historical Society Museum and Cultural Center provides a glimpse into the region's rich history, while the Indian Rocks Historical Museum adds to the cultural tapestry.
Dining options are plentiful, with favorites such as Frenchy's Rockaway Grill and The Original Crabby Bill's serving up delicious seafood, while Cristino's Coal Oven Pizza offers a taste of Italy. For a more casual bite, Keke's Breakfast Cafe and Rockstar Donuts provide delightful morning treats, ensuring that every meal is a memorable experience. Shopping enthusiasts can explore nearby Largo Plaza and Paradise Shops of Largo, where a variety of stores cater to all needs.
Nature lovers can venture to Caladesi Island State Park, renowned for its pristine beaches and nature trails, or enjoy the lush landscapes of the Florida Botanical Gardens. The friendly atmosphere, beautiful surroundings, and convenient amenities make Belleair Beach an appealing destination for those seeking a relaxed lifestyle by the water, enriched by the vibrant offerings of nearby shopping centers, restaurants, and cultural sites.
